Read book on Brueghel

I had planned to finish this in September, which I would have managed had I started reading it in April, but I didn't begin until June, so I've only just finished now.  But it's still done within the year.

This book has almost all the paintings by Brueghel the Elder.  I had requested it as a Christmas present, and had read up on a few of the paintings, but this time I worked all through the book.  The paintings themselves are wonderful - very detailed and certainly worth looking at closely.  The book was semi-interesting, helpfully pointing out details not to be missed, but at the same time the theological interpretation was very much of the author and extremely narrow-minded.  Every painting was examined in the same way, and I frequently disagreed with the interpretation.

Having said that, I didn't want the book for the commentary, but to have the paintings and the challenge this year was to look properly at them, so I was happy with the outcome.
